    Ask any experienced recruiter and they’ll tell you that preparation and authenticity consistently set candidates apart.

    In this episode of Before the Hire, Juliet Goswell, Director of Recruiting at Betts Recruiting, shares an insider’s perspective on sourcing and interviewing go-to-market candidates. She breaks down which sourcing platforms Betts recruiters use to find talent and why the most effective candidate profiles are often simple rather than overproduced.

    She also discusses how candidates can make a strong first impression in interviews, the importance of clearly articulating what motivates their career decisions, common candidate red flags, and why being grounded, prepared, and authentic often matters more than an impressive resume.

    About Juliet Goswell: Juliet Goswell is the Director of Recruiting at Betts, where she leads the New York office and oversees teams ranging from recruiting coordinators to GTM recruiters and account managers. She’s been in recruiting for about five years and took a nontraditional path into the field, starting with a background in modern dance before moving into ad tech and influencer partnerships. That people-driven work led her into recruiting at StudioID, where she managed a large freelance network and began building leadership experience, followed by agency recruiting at Creative People. Juliet joined Betts a few years ago as an individual contributor and has since stepped into leadership, now leading the New York office.

    Some founders start with a clear idea. Others start with a question.

    In this episode of Beyond the Hire, Justin Liu, CEO and co founder of Charta Health, walks us through the unconventional path that led to building Charta, including spending over a year interviewing hundreds of operators across industries and validating what could truly become a venture scale business.

    He also shares how those early decisions shape how he hires today, why Charta prioritizes an in person culture, and what surprised him most after stepping into the CEO role for the first time.

    About Justin Liu: Justin Liu is the CEO and co-founder of Charta Health, an AI Chart Review Platform transforming how healthcare organizations audit patient charts and documentation at scale. Charta streamlines critical workflows across revenue cycle, clinical operations, and compliance functions, helping providers and payers operate more efficiently and deliver better patient care. Backed by Bain Capital Ventures, Charta is on a mission to make every healthcare dollar accountable and every chart accurate, simplifying the complexities of non-clinical operations from the ground up.

    Before founding Charta, Justin led Growth at Rockset (acquired by OpenAI) and worked on Google’s Cloud Security team. His background in scaling cutting-edge AI technology is central to Charta’s success in transforming healthcare infrastructure.

    What does it take to build real community in venture capital, and how can it shape your entire career?

    In this episode of Beyond the Hire, Niamh O’Donnell shares how she went from running her own company at sixteen to working inside Ireland’s most influential innovation ecosystem and ultimately landing in the Bay Area. She breaks down how thoughtful networking opens doors, why intention matters more than transaction, and why founders and future investors should embed themselves in the right circles early on.

    Niamh also offers a candid look at her work at Unusual Ventures, what makes standout founders and teams, and the traits that help people thrive in zero to one environments.

    About Niamh O’Donnell: Niamh O’Donnell is the Director of Programs at Unusual, where she runs Unusual Academy and other initiatives to help early-stage founders access the right insights and connections at the right time. Her expertise stems from prior roles at 500 Global, where she led co-investor relations, Enterprise Ireland, where she helped Irish startups expand into the US, and Notre Dame’s IDEA Center, where she supported the commercialization of emerging startups. Before that, Niamh worked at the forefront of XR and generative AI at Ascend Learning and was an award-winning entrepreneur herself, lending her rare empathy to the pace and ambiguity of the zero-to-one stage. Niamh holds degrees from The University of Notre Dame, KEDGE Business School, and Dublin City University, and lives in San Francisco.
